My 830 is unhappy with trickle feed enabled. The symptom is that the image on the screen shifts a bit to right occasionally. The BIOS initially disables trickle feed, but it gets reset during suspend, so we need to re-disable it ourselves. Juse disable it always. Also disable it for all other gen2/3 platforms since we disable it for all more recent platforms as well (until HSW that is). At least my 855 doesn't seem to mind us doing this. I don't have gen3 hardware to test that. Signed-off-by: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com> Signed-off-by: Daniel Vetter <daniel.vetter@ffwll.ch> |
